D.R. Horton Inc · Q4 2024 earnings
Q4 2024 earnings · · Investor relations
Briefing
Reported a decrease in revenue and net income compared to the same quarter last year, while home sales revenue increased.
D.R. Horton reported Q4 earnings with a decrease in consolidated revenues and net income compared to the same quarter last year. Despite affordability challenges, net sales orders increased slightly. The company is focused on affordable product offerings and expects increasing operating cash flows in fiscal 2025.
- Earnings per diluted share were $3.92 on net income of $1.3 billion.
- Consolidated revenues decreased 5% to $10.0 billion.
- Home sales revenues increased 2% to $9.0 billion on 23,647 homes closed.
- Net sales orders increased 1% to 19,035 homes.

Forward guidance
D.R. Horton provided initial guidance for fiscal year 2025, including consolidated revenues of approximately $36.0 billion to $37.5 billion and homes closed by homebuilding operations of 90,000 homes to 92,000 homes.
Tailwinds
- Consolidated revenues of approximately $36.0 billion to $37.5 billion
- Homes closed by homebuilding operations of 90,000 homes to 92,000 homes
- Income tax rate of approximately 24.5%
- Consolidated cash flow provided by operations greater than fiscal 2024
- Share repurchases of approximately $2.4 billion and dividend payments of approximately $500 million
